Design Brainstorm: Capturing the Aesthetic
Translating this fervent loyalty into unique merchandise requires a thoughtful artistic approach. One compelling direction involves merging iconic club symbolism with a distinct art style.
- 🎨 Visual Concept: The central idea here revolves around a bold, graphic representation of the ‘Liver bird,’ the legendary symbol inextricably linked to the city of Liverpool. The aesthetic draws inspiration from classic German ‘Plakatstil’ (poster style) design. This translates to clean, confident lines, striking flat colors, and a strong central image that immediately commands attention. Imagine the Liver bird rendered in a powerful, stoic pose, perhaps with a subtle, almost architectural feel, giving it a timeless and formidable presence. This approach aims to capture the essence of Liverpool’s heritage in a visually impactful, art-forward manner.
- ✍️ Typography Ideas: For this particular design concept, the power lies in its silent strength. The strategic choice here is to feature no text at all. This allows the iconic Liver bird graphic, rendered in its ‘Plakatstil’ glory, to speak entirely for itself. By omitting text, the design transcends language barriers and avoids any direct club or league branding, ensuring broad appeal and sidestepping common intellectual property pitfalls. The pure visual focus enhances the artistic integrity and emphasizes the universal recognition of the symbol among true fans.
- 👕 Product Canvas: Given the prompt’s focus on ‘light’ apparel, this striking design would truly pop on lighter-colored t-shirts, hoodies, or even tote bags. A crisp white or a pale heather grey could provide the perfect backdrop, allowing the bold lines and flat colors of the Liver bird to stand out with maximum contrast and clarity, aligning perfectly with the clean aesthetic of Plakatstil.

How does using the Liver bird avoid IP issues while still appealing to Liverpool fans?
The Liver bird is the official symbol of the city of Liverpool, not solely the football club. As a public domain symbol, its use for design purposes avoids direct infringement of the football club’s specific branding or trademarks. For true fans, the Liver bird is an instantly recognizable and deeply cherished icon that represents the spirit and identity of the city and, by extension, its famous football club, allowing for a respectful and legally sound way to celebrate their allegiance.
